Norway
IX / X th century

Many artifacts have been discovered at the Oseberg dig site in Norway.
In particular these high shoes or ankle boots called "172", according to the work of Margareth Hald, on the same excavation site as the Oseberg "303" shoes but higher and without snail clasps.
Defined by "Oseberg Boots", they are often reconstructed at an exaggerated size much higher than the original version kept in the museum.

The Oseberg excavation site appears to be an important burial site on an impressive boat. One of the most complete testimonies to Norway's Viking past. Many artifacts have been discovered there.
